Abstract:
      The drying characteristic of sulfate titanium slag was studied by hot-air drying and microwave drying respectively. The influence of the power and sample mass on the average drying rate was obtained in the process of microwave drying, and compared with the hot-air drying process. The results show that in hot-air drying, the average drying rate increased with increasing temperature and decreased with increasing sample mass. In the microwave drying, the average drying rate increased with both microwave power and sample mass, and the average drying rate of sulfate titanium slag by microwave drying higher than the hot-air drying. In general, for drying sulfate titanium slag, microwave has a higher drying rate and drying depth than the hot-air drying method, and microwave drying has obvious advantages in energy saving.
